ABSTRACT:
An hairdressing iron is described comprising a rod, a metal channel coaxial to the rod and attached to the latter in such a way as to swivel in relation to the latter around a transversal axis. The outer surface of the rod presents a longitudinal groove and the iron comprises a second channel adopted to fit longitudinally on the outer surface of the rod, said second channel comprising on its inner surface an elastic component capable of being inserted in the said longitudinal groove in order to retain the second channel on the rod. The outer surface of said second channel may be fitted with one or more rows of teeth projecting from that surface. An articulated U-link may also be provided in such a way as to be swivellable around the transversal swivelling axis for serving as a supporting member when it is in the unfolded position.
